There are plenty of puzzle types about the aquatic life which may be downloaded and installed on today's smart phones and tablets. Some of the most popular ones are those that involve finding hidden objects. Players have to look for and tap on the items specified on a list. They are strewn all over the ocean floor usually together with other unnecessary things.

Such kind of puzzle will test the sharpness of the player's eyes. Anyone who thinks this is a simple game may change his or her mind as soon as the app is launched. This is especially true if every stage or challenge has a time limit that further adds to the excitement. Kids can benefit from easier versions as the game helps with their developing eye-hand coordination.

Jigsaw puzzle varieties are perfect for little ones. Since all of them are related to the exciting life under the sea, it's for sure that young minds are going to be entertained and awestruck as well. These high-tech leisure pursuits are perfect for keeping away boredom. What's more, they help kids make the right decisions as well as encourage them to complete goals.

The slide puzzle types are trickier than their counterparts that involve placing jigsaw pieces in the right places to complete an underwater scene or a picture of an aquatic animal. That's why these game selections are ideal for older kids as they really need to think logically. Many adults will also find sliding those pieces of the puzzle around a very challenging task.

As for very young kids, there are plenty of educational games suited for their developing minds. Most of the options on the market for smart phones and tablets have something to do with shapes, colors, numbers and the alphabet. Because the backgrounds or design elements used have something to do with life in the ocean, learning can be very enjoyable for them.
